The Evolution of Mobile in Online Gambling
Historically, online casinos operated predominantly through desktop platforms, with mobile versions considered secondary. However, the rapid proliferation of mobile internet access – particularly in Australasia where mobile penetration exceeds 90% (source: Australian Communications and Media Authority, 2023) – has catalyzed a transformation in user behavior. Players now expect seamless, instant access to their favorite games anytime and anywhere, compelling operators to adapt swiftly.
Leading industry players have invested heavily in responsive design, progressive web apps (PWAs), and native mobile applications. Such adaptations not only support recreational gaming but also bolster regulatory compliance and security standards inherent in mobile payment systems.
Technical and Design Considerations for Mobile Optimization
Optimizing for mobile involves addressing several key factors:
- User Interface (UI): Simplified navigation, larger touch targets, and minimalistic layouts enhance user engagement.
- Performance: Fast load times—ideally under 3 seconds—are critical, especially given the higher bounce rates associated with laggy apps.
- Security: Robust encryption, biometric authentication, and compliance with data protection standards foster trust among players.
- Functionality: Inclusion of popular payment methods, live dealer streams, and multi-language support integrates a comprehensive experience.

Industry Insights: Future Trends in Mobile Gambling
Technological advancements, such as 5G connectivity and foldable-screen devices, will redefine mobile gaming dynamics. Casinos integrating augmented reality (AR) and virtual reality (VR) into their mobile offerings are set to elevate immersive experiences, attracting a broader demographic, including tech-savvy Millennials and Generation Z.
